#06ffe2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06ffe2 is composed of 2.4% red, 100%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.4%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 173 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 51.2%. #06ffe2 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ffff with #00ffc5.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#06ffe2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000605 is the darkest color, while #f1fff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#06ffe2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#798c8a is the less saturated color, while #06ffe2 is the most saturated one.
